Where can I find a FireFox ver 2.0 rpm for RedHat 9 ?
Thanks
RH 9 has not been supported for quite some time. You can find Linux
tarballs for Firefox on their web site and may be able to install it
that way on RH 9.
Otherwise, I would urge you to upgrade to a current distro. If you want
to stay with RH based distros, Fedora 7 is the current version.
